Types of EV Chargers

The EV charging industry offers a variety of charger types, each with its unique features and benefits. Here are some of the most common types of EV chargers:

Level 1 Chargers

Level 1 chargers are the most basic type of EV charger, typically using a standard household outlet. They are slowest in terms of charging speed, taking anywhere from 8 to 12 hours to fully charge a typical EV battery. While they are convenient for overnight charging at home, they are not suitable for frequent or fast charging needs.

Level 2 Chargers

Level 2 chargers are more powerful than Level 1 chargers and can charge an EV battery in about 4 to 6 hours. They are commonly used in public charging stations, workplaces, and residential areas. Level 2 chargers require a dedicated circuit and are available in various power outputs, ranging from 7.2kW to 22kW.

Level 3 Chargers

Level 3 chargers, also known as DC fast chargers, are the fastest type of EV charger. They can charge an EV battery in as little as 15 to 30 minutes, depending on the charger’s power output and the vehicle’s charging capabilities. Level 3 chargers are primarily found in public charging stations and are ideal for long-distance travel.

Smart Charging Technology

Smart charging technology is becoming increasingly popular in the EV charging industry. It allows EV owners to schedule charging sessions, optimize charging times based on electricity rates, and monitor their charging progress remotely. The best EV charger with smart charging capabilities enhances user convenience and can help reduce energy costs.
